hi i did a 14 day observership at a teaching hospital. I didnot ask for LOR as rotations were such that i couldnt interact with one attending more than twice sometimes even once. Now mentioning such an observership without LOR does that sound odd? What if someone do get an LOR from an observership but decides not to use it because it is weak or doesnt pertain to that particular specialty?

I did an observership and did not get any LOR (didn't ask either). If somebody asks you why, just say you thought letters from people who know you better and longer would be more valuable.
